Add ALL of Your Inventory

Treat Marketplace as you would any other third-party sales platform – upload ALL your current inventory listings. Facebook Marketplace recently banned mass inventory uploads through a feed, but the good news is that you can still partner with a third-party tool so that you don’t have to list your units manually and individually.

Optimize Your Listings

The Facebook Marketplace algorithm shows buyers products that are similar to what they’ve searched for in the past. Use this to your advantage by filling out your listings with the tags and descriptions that buyers are likely to use in their online search. This will help your listings appear in more search results on Marketplace and drive more buyers to your inventory.

Advertise on Facebook

Once your listings are live, it’s time to take an extra step to tap into the local market. Facebook Marketplace ads get your listings in front of buyers who have shown interest in similar units, increasing your likelihood of making a sale. You can choose from multiple objectives and ad formats according to your sales goals and what you think will most appeal to your audience. Best of all, you can customize your target audience based on demographic, location, age, interests and more to invest 100% of your ad spend in promising leads.

Market on Messenger

Facebook Messenger has become more than just an app to converse with your friends. Buyers are turning to Messenger to connect with businesses on a more direct and personal level. Messenger is a convenient avenue to send your customers important information, such as service reminders, sales notifications and even your latest blog. According to automation brand Mobile Monkey, Facebook Messenger has an 80% open rate, as reported by Mobile Monkey, which is much higher than the 15-25% average for email.

Automate Your Customer Service

Facebook Marketplace presents an enormous customer service opportunity for dealerships, partly because of its large audience, but also because it offers a variety of tools to simplify your customer engagement. For example, launching a Messenger chatbot allows you to auto-answer frequently asked questions, such as your dealership contact information and store hours.

If you’re selling inventory on Marketplace, you need to be monitoring your messaging avenues and responding regularly. If you don’t have the time or staff to dedicate to answering messages, that’s where Facebook’s automation tools can really help. Create an instant reply that notifies shoppers you’ve seen their message and a member of your team will be reaching out soon. Some dealerships even find that their chatbot helps generate organic-feeling conversations with customers without typing out a single word.
